Output e66fbb13bfaef8f18e87df4e1f1952aca79bf8513bee52dba86e7f8a66926640:0

value
178918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62800d69da84cec81d33d960e44dd186833f6bc4 OP_EQUAL
address
3AfqYaa6JqEcv6X2VDYMHzKjpyWUo3xg7E
transaction
e66fbb13bfaef8f18e87df4e1f1952aca79bf8513bee52dba86e7f8a66926640
confirmations
147445
spent
true